We routinely get asked by new players in the United Kingdom what GamStop is and how it could affect their gambling activities. In sum, GamStop is Britain’s national self-exclusion scheme that enjoys the full support of the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) and the country’s gambling industry. It’s an effort to eradicate gambling addiction, which has spread across England, Wales, Scotland, and Northern Ireland.

The GamStop registry involves both the UKGC-licensed online gambling establishments, such as bookmakers and casinos, and the players who voluntarily ask to be blocked from the participating gaming platforms. These GamStop-listed wagering sites are compelled by law to honour the players’ request and not let them play whilst their self-imposed ban is in force. GamStop is a free service that’s available to residents of the UK.

GamStop Self-Exclusion: Step-by-Step Registration Process

  1. Access the GamStop site. Go to the GamStop site and click on the ‘Get Started’ button. Read the preliminary information under the ‘Before You Start’ heading. Next, click on the ‘Start’ button at the bottom of the page.
  2. Fill out the registration form. Begin the sign-up process by reading the Privacy Policy, which concerns the protection of your data. Enter your e-mail address, to which a verification code and registration link will be sent. Key in your details, including your full name, date of birth, current address, and mobile number.
  3. Set the exclusion period. Select the duration of your voluntary blockage from every wagering site listed on GamStop. The shortest exclusion period is 180 days (or 6 months), whilst the longest is 120 months (or 5 years).
  4. Review and confirm the information. Check the personal details that you’ve entered. Make sure that they’re correctly spelt and the same as the details in your valid personal identification document (such as driving licence or passport). Review your selected exclusion period, too, then confirm.
  5. Finish the confirmation process. After submitting your personal details, you’ll receive an e-mail containing the confirmation, along with practical tools to help you keep your gambling habits in check. Your self-exclusion takes effect within 24 hours of confirmation.

After GamStop Registration: What to Expect

Your GamStop confirmation comes with an account, in which you can update your details, such as a new mobile number or e-mail address. This will help strengthen your commitment to take a break from gambling, particularly online wagering at virtual casinos and bookies. This will also point you to additional resources, in case you feel that your willpower is slipping, and you need support in adjusting to a GamStop-restricted life. You may renew your voluntary restriction period when you’ve completed it, but you may not end your GamStop self-exclusion prematurely.

Frequently Asked Questions About GamStop

Can I cancel my GamStop registration?

No, you can’t cancel your registration. There’s no way for the registry’s system to reverse GamStop and remove you from self-exclusion. Your voluntary blockage from UKGC-licensed gambling platforms will remain effective until your chosen period has ended.

Does GamStop cover all gambling sites?

No, GamStop doesn’t cover all gambling sites. The registry only includes wagering platforms that hold UKGC licences and are legally operating in Great Britain and Northern Ireland.

Is it possible to modify the exclusion period after registration?

No, it’s not possible to modify the exclusion period after registration. The period you’ve selected is fixed, so you’ll have to wait until it expires for you to return to placing bets on UKGC-licenced gambling platforms.

Can I register for someone else on GamStop?

No, you can’t register for someone else on GamStop. Signing up on behalf of family members or friends isn’t allowed. This is expressly stated in the GamStop Terms of Use.
